Honestly, I'd have released it weeks ago as 'unstable', we'd have
gotten more testing and a stable version faster.  There is no point in
_not_ releasing unstable versions when there is already an older
stable version.

Ideally we always have a stable release and an unstable release on the
go, plus the bleeding edge github master.  Part of the joy for
contributors is finding bugs and getting involved like that in the
collaborative development process.

Release early, release often... and if the release process is too
manual, I'll help automate it until it's as simple as the OpenAMQ
release process (one command does the whole thing).
